Output 21ba75e9f0518ba7d24aa2a9b1480a0a7cf662cfa53a9e277efbcac729d0d606:1

value
2633979
script pubkey
OP_0 OP_PUSHBYTES_20 8835fb54c9d2612af94efca4336a51c1c7d65e61
address
ltc1q3q6lk4xf6fsj472wljjrx6j3c8ravhnpj90m9t
transaction
21ba75e9f0518ba7d24aa2a9b1480a0a7cf662cfa53a9e277efbcac729d0d606
spent
true